Unstoppable comedy, ultimate entertainment, and full-on family fun!
Get ready for an evening full of laughter with the legendary Gujarati comedy icon Siddharth Randeria in the superhit stage play “Gujjubhai ni Exchange Offer.”
Known for his impeccable comic timing and unforgettable characters, Siddharth Randeria brings to life the beloved character Gujjubhai in a hilarious story filled with witty dialogues, unexpected twists, and relatable family humor.
